This PR reintroduces #47283 but with more refactoring done to the runner to get around the issue that caused it to get reverted in #47627.

The issue at hand was that upon test completion the worker gets intentionally terminated, the worker got terminated based on a Map<string, Worker> where the key is the filename. That was not a problem until concurrency got introduced which meant that the same file but with different query string variants which didn't affect the key were added to the Map. This has lead to some multi variant test workers to get terminated. I've fixed this issue with the refactors explained below and confirmed that it's fixed by comparing the number of individual executed tests to be the same as on main (and in record time).

I've refactored the runner as follows:

  • variants are no longer a second iteration within WPTRunner.prototype.runJsTests()
    • variants are instead detected during StatusLoader.prototype.load() and each variant gets it's own WPTTestSpec instance.
  • methods where filename was used as an argument get a WPTTestSpec instance instead
  • referencing WPTTestSpec instances in maps is no longer done with their filename but instead a unique Symbol Sets are used instead.
    • this means when a spec completes the worker that gets terminated is always the correct one
  • more type annotations were added

With this in place then

  • When it comes to worker management a unique Symbol per WPTTestSpec is now used the WPTTestSpec is now used instead of string/symbol references.
  • (no change) When it comes to expectation files WPTTestSpec's filename continues to be used
  • (no change) When it comes to the WPT Report WPTTestSpec's filename + variant continues to be used

Additionally:

  • it is now possible to run a single test with a variant like so
./node ./test/wpt/test-webcrypto.js 'generateKey/successes_RSA-PSS.https.any.js?11-20'
  • failed test commands get printed using the above syntax when the failure is within a variant test
  • the logs got cleaned up a bit
  • ResourceLoader.prototype.read got split into read and readAsFetch, the former is used within the WPTRunner, the latter only from the spawned workers
